不同种株旋毛虫肌肉期幼虫温变形态观察比较

Observation and comparison of the muscle larvae of different trichinella species and isolates at different temperature

【摘要】 目的探索我国是否存在旋毛虫的不同类型及其在生物学性状方面与布氏旋毛虫(T.britovi,T3)和南方旋毛虫(T.nelsoni,T7)存在的差异。方法在4℃低温下观察云南、湖北、黑龙江、河南4地和2株国际标准株(T3、T7)旋毛虫肌肉期幼虫(ML)形态及其分布。结果 4地旋毛虫及2株国际标准株旋毛虫 ML 形态分布各不相同,呈螺旋状卷曲者所占的比例分别为14.1%、41.1%、12.1%、39.5%、3.5%和25.7%。其中湖北株、河南株比例接近,并且比例较高;云南株、黑龙江株分布比例接近,比例较低。该四株与 T3、T7比例皆相差较远。云南、湖北、黑龙江、河南4地和2株国际标准株(T3、T7)的温变率分别为3.92、9.86、6.72、9.40、2.43、11.68。结论我国4地与2株国际标准株旋毛虫 ML 在低温下形态上存在着明显的差异,提示我国4地旋毛虫存在2种不同的生物学类型,且与国际标准株(T3,T7)的亲缘关系较远。

【Abstract】 Objective To explore whether there are different types of trichinella in China and to learn where there are any difference in bio-character between them and T.britovi or T.nelsoni.Methods Muscle larvaes of Trichinella isolates obtained from Yunnan,Hubei,Heilongjiang,Henan province and species of T. britovi and T.nelsoni were observed at low temperature.Results Four Triehinella isolates obtained in China were different from each other.They were also different from T.britovi and T.nelsoni in morphology.The spiral-crimpy rate was 14.1%,41.1%,12.1%,39.5%,3.5% and 25.7%,respectively.Ratio of spiral-crimp rate at low temperature to that at normal temperature was 3.92,9.86,6.72,9.40,2.43,11.68,respectively. Conclusion The muscle larvae of the four Trichinella isolates in China are distinctly different from T.britovi and T.nelsoni in morphology at low temperature;it indicates that there are two different biological types of the four Trichinella isolates in China,which are not likely to be the same specie of T.britovi or T.nelsoni.
